1. What Is An Immutable Ledger?

An immutable ledger is a database that is maintained in a way that prevents any data from being modified, tampered with, or deleted. This is achieved through the use of advanced cryptographic techniques, such as hashing and digital signatures, that ensure the integrity of the data. Once data is recorded on an immutable ledger, it becomes a permanent and unalterable part of the blockchain network.


A. The Benefits Of Immutable Ledgers

There are several key benefits to using an immutable ledger, including:


I. Security: The immutability of the ledger ensures that data cannot be altered or deleted, making it much more secure than traditional record-keeping methods.


II. Transparency: The use of an immutable ledger provides complete transparency into the history of a particular record, making it easy to track and verify changes over time.


III. Efficiency: The use of blockchain technology allows for a distributed network of computers to maintain the ledger, eliminating the need for a central authority and reducing the potential for errors or fraud.


IV. Trust: The immutability of the ledger creates a sense of trust between parties, as it ensures that data cannot be manipulated or corrupted.


B. Use Cases for Immutable Ledgers

The use of immutable ledgers is becoming increasingly prevalent in a variety of industries. Some of the most common use cases include:


I. Financial Services: The use of immutable ledgers in the financial industry can help to improve transparency and reduce the risk of fraud.


II. Supply Chain Management: By using an immutable ledger to track the movement of goods, supply chain management becomes much more efficient and transparent.


III. Real Estate: The use of immutable ledgers in real estate can help to reduce the potential for fraud and errors in property transactions.


IV. Healthcare: The use of immutable ledgers in healthcare can help to improve patient data security and reduce the risk of medical errors.


C. Challenges of Immutable Ledgers

While the benefits of immutable ledgers are clear, there are still some challenges that need to be addressed. These include:


I. Scalability: As the amount of data stored on the ledger grows, it can become increasingly difficult to maintain the network and ensure the integrity of the data.


II. Adoption: While blockchain technology is becoming more widely adopted, there is still a lack of awareness and understanding of the benefits of immutable ledgers.


III. Interoperability: As different blockchain networks emerge, there is a need for interoperability between different ledgers to ensure that data can be easily shared and accessed.
